Exploring Perspectives and Controversies in Steel Manufacturing: Books and Documentaries Reviews

Steel manufacturing is a crucial industry that has played a significant role in shaping the modern world. From skyscrapers to automobiles, steel is a foundational material that we rely on in countless ways. However, the process of steel production is not without its controversies and complexities. In this blog post, we will explore different perspectives on steel manufacturing through the lens of books and documentaries that delve into this fascinating industry. 1. "Steel: From Mine to Mill, the Metal That Made America" by Brooke C. Stoddard In this comprehensive book, Stoddard takes readers on a journey through the history of steel in America. He explores the industry's origins, its growth during the Industrial Revolution, and its impact on the country's economy and infrastructure. The book also delves into the social and environmental consequences of steel manufacturing, providing a well-rounded perspective on the subject. 2. "Manufactured Landscapes" (2006) - Directed by Jennifer Baichwal This thought-provoking documentary follows renowned photographer Edward Burtynsky as he captures the massive industrial landscapes created by activities such as steel manufacturing. Through stunning visuals, the film highlights the scale of human impact on the environment and raises questions about sustainability and ethics in industrial processes. 3. "Steel Town" (2017) - Directed by Saida Medvedeva Set in a steel town in Russia, this documentary offers a glimpse into the lives of workers and residents affected by the local steel plant. The film explores the economic challenges faced by the community, as well as the environmental issues resulting from the plant's operations. "Steel Town" provides a poignant portrayal of the human side of steel manufacturing. 4. "Trouble in the Heartland: Steel Mill Closings in the 1980s" by Michael Johnston Johnston's book examines the closure of steel mills across the United States in the 1980s and its profound impact on workers, families, and communities. By analyzing the political and economic factors that led to these closures, the author sheds light on the challenges faced by the steel industry and its stakeholders. As we can see from these books and documentaries, steel manufacturing is a multifaceted industry with far-reaching implications. While steel plays a crucial role in our society, it is essential to consider the social, environmental, and economic aspects of its production. By exploring different perspectives and controversies surrounding steel manufacturing, we can gain a deeper understanding of this vital but complex industry.
